The high-risk mission goes on. After Dhurandhar became a blockbuster, its sequel Dhurandhar Part 2 (Revenge) has been confirmed. The Ranveer Singh film will hit theatres on March 19, 2026, clashing with Yash’s Toxic.
The announcement follows a cliffhanger ending in the first film, which released on December 5, 2025. A four-minute post-credit scene worked like a direct preview for Part 2, creating huge excitement. The fast sequel hints that both films were shot back-to-back to keep the story flowing smoothly.

Dhurandhar 2 Story and Plot
The plot picks up from the shocking reveal that Ranveer Singh’s character, Hamza Ali Mazari, is actually Jaskirat Singh Rangi, an undercover Indian agent. Dhurandhar 2 will follow Jaskirat as he consolidates power in Pakistan’s underworld to target his final enemy: the terror mastermind ‘Bade Sahab’ (Major Iqbal).
The sequel will dig into Jaskirat’s transformation, his demanding training with mentor Ajay Sanyal, and the mental burden of leading two lives. Revenge signals a turn from silent infiltration to face-to-face conflict, setting up a larger story and a conclusive ending.
Dhurandhar 2 Cast
The main ensemble from the first film is set to return:
- Ranveer Singh as Hamza Ali Mazari / Jaskirat Singh Rangi
- R. Madhavan as Ajay Sanyal (IB Director)
- Arjun Rampal as Major Iqbal / ‘Bade Sahab’ (the antagonist)
- Sanjay Dutt as SP Chaudhary Aslam
- Sara Arjun as Yalina Jamali
- Akshaye Khanna will not return as his character, Rehman Dakait, concluded his arc in the first film.

Is Dhurandhar Based on a True Story?
No. Director Aditya Dhar has clearly stated that Dhurandhar is not a biopic and is not inspired by the life of Major Mohit Sharma.The clarification came after the late soldier’s family raised concerns.The filmmaker stated it is a fictional story, though it draws inspiration from real-life geopolitical events like the 2008 Mumbai attacks for its narrative context.
